
思科模拟器如何配置Web服务器:
步骤1:选择合适的模拟器、配置网络拓扑、配置路由器和交换机、配置Web服务器。为了更好地理解整个过程,这里将详细介绍如何在思科模拟器中配置Web服务器。
一、选择合适的模拟器
思科模拟器有多种选择,常见的包括Cisco Packet Tracer和GNS3。Cisco Packet Tracer是初学者常用的模拟器,具备简单易用的界面和丰富的功能,适合学习和练习网络配置。GNS3则是更为专业的模拟器,适合高级用户,需要安装真实的Cisco IOS镜像。
1.1 Cisco Packet Tracer
Packet Tracer是思科推出的模拟器软件,适用于各类网络设备的配置和调试。下载并安装Packet Tracer,开始创建网络拓扑。
1.2 GNS3
GNS3是一款开源的网络模拟器,支持多种网络设备的仿真,适合需要更高仿真度的用户。下载并安装GNS3,导入合适的思科IOS镜像。
二、配置网络拓扑
在模拟器中创建一个简单的网络拓扑,包括路由器、交换机和Web服务器。通过添加这些设备,并用网线将它们连接起来。
2.1 添加设备
在模拟器中,选择并拖动路由器、交换机和PC(用于模拟Web服务器)到工作区。
2.2 连接设备
使用网线工具,将路由器、交换机和PC连接起来。确保每个设备都有正确的连接,并且端口配置正确。
三、配置路由器和交换机
在网络拓扑中,配置路由器和交换机以确保网络通信正常。
3.1 配置路由器
进入路由器的命令行界面,配置基本的IP地址和路由信息。例如:
Router> enable
Router# configure terminal
Router(config)# interface gigabitEthernet 0/0
Router(config-if)# ip address 192.168.1.1 255.255.255.0
Router(config-if)# no shutdown
Router(config-if)# exit
Router(config)# ip route 0.0.0.0 0.0.0.0 192.168.1.2
Router(config)# end
Router# write memory
3.2 配置交换机
进入交换机的命令行界面,配置基本的VLAN和端口。例如:
Switch> enable
Switch# configure terminal
Switch(config)# vlan 1
Switch(config-vlan)# exit
Switch(config)# interface gigabitEthernet 0/1
Switch(config-if)# switchport mode access
Switch(config-if)# switchport access vlan 1
Switch(config-if)# no shutdown
Switch(config-if)# exit
Switch(config)# end
Switch# write memory
四、配置Web服务器
在模拟器中,配置PC作为Web服务器,并安装和配置Web服务器软件。
4.1 配置PC的IP地址
在PC的命令行界面,设置IP地址。例如:
PC> ip 192.168.1.2 255.255.255.0 192.168.1.1
4.2 安装Web服务器软件
在模拟器中,选择PC并安装Web服务器软件(如Apache或IIS)。在Cisco Packet Tracer中,可以直接从服务选项中启用HTTP服务。
4.3 配置Web服务器软件
根据安装的软件,进行基本的配置。例如,在Apache中,可以编辑配置文件:
# 编辑Apache配置文件
<VirtualHost *:80>
DocumentRoot "/var/www/html"
ServerName www.example.com
</VirtualHost>
五、测试Web服务器
配置完成后,使用浏览器访问Web服务器的IP地址,检查是否能正确显示网页内容。例如,打开浏览器并访问http://192.168.1.2。
六、故障排除
如果在配置过程中遇到问题,可以通过以下步骤进行故障排除:
6.1 检查网络连接
确保所有设备之间的网络连接正常,可以使用ping命令测试连接。例如:
PC> ping 192.168.1.1
PC> ping 192.168.1.2
6.2 检查配置文件
检查路由器、交换机和PC的配置文件,确保所有配置正确无误。
七、优化和维护
配置完Web服务器后,可以进行优化和维护。例如,配置防火墙、启用SSL证书等,以提高Web服务器的安全性和性能。
7.1 配置防火墙
在路由器上配置访问控制列表(ACL),限制对Web服务器的访问。例如:
Router> enable
Router# configure terminal
Router(config)# access-list 100 permit tcp any host 192.168.1.2 eq 80
Router(config)# interface gigabitEthernet 0/0
Router(config-if)# ip access-group 100 in
Router(config-if)# end
Router# write memory
7.2 启用SSL证书
在Web服务器上配置SSL证书,提高数据传输的安全性。例如,在Apache中,可以编辑配置文件:
# 编辑Apache SSL配置文件
<VirtualHost *:443>
DocumentRoot "/var/www/html"
ServerName www.example.com
SSLEngine on
SSLCertificateFile "/etc/ssl/certs/server.crt"
SSLCertificateKeyFile "/etc/ssl/private/server.key"
</VirtualHost>
八、使用项目管理工具
在配置和管理Web服务器的过程中,可以借助项目管理工具提高效率和协作能力。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ile。
8.1 PingCode
PingCode是一款专业的研发项目管理系统,支持任务管理、需求管理、缺陷管理等功能,适用于复杂的研发项目。
8.2 Worktile
Worktile是一款通用项目协作软件,支持任务管理、团队协作、文档管理等功能,适用于各种类型的项目管理。
总结
通过以上步骤,可以在思科模拟器中成功配置Web服务器。选择合适的模拟器、配置网络拓扑、配置路由器和交换机、配置Web服务器是关键步骤。配置完成后,通过测试和优化,确保Web服务器的稳定运行。使用项目管理工具,如PingCode和Worktile,可以提高配置和管理过程的效率和协作能力。
相关问答FAQs:
Q: 如何配置思科模拟器上的web服务器?
A: 首先,确保你已经在思科模拟器上正确安装并运行了web服务器软件。然后,按照以下步骤进行配置:
-
如何在思科模拟器中创建一个虚拟网络?
在思科模拟器的控制台中,找到网络设置选项。点击创建虚拟网络,并按照提示输入网络名称、IP地址范围和子网掩码等信息。 -
如何将虚拟机连接到虚拟网络?
在思科模拟器中,选择要连接到虚拟网络的虚拟机。找到网络设置选项,选择你刚创建的虚拟网络,并保存更改。 -
如何在思科模拟器上安装并配置web服务器软件?
在虚拟机上打开终端或命令提示符,然后使用合适的包管理工具安装web服务器软件,如Apache或Nginx。安装完成后,编辑配置文件以指定服务器监听的端口号、根目录等信息。 -
如何测试配置的web服务器是否正常工作?
在虚拟机上启动web服务器,然后使用模拟器中的浏览器或任意浏览器访问虚拟机的IP地址和配置的端口号。如果能够看到web服务器默认页面或配置的网页内容,则说明配置成功。
请注意,具体的配置步骤可能因使用的思科模拟器版本和web服务器软件而有所不同。建议参考思科模拟器和web服务器软件的官方文档以获取更详细的配置指南。
文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2962447